Transaction f0766acfc4993714d3fd51c20d9df74217f29b0113adf118a71c052f65e5c6c8
1 Input
1 Output
-
f0766acfc4993714d3fd51c20d9df74217f29b0113adf118a71c052f65e5c6c8:0
- value
- 132648
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 887d3988045f1100a541e8022f82436cc11813a7 OP_EQUAL
- address
- 3E8hqQ8TPR1QJY4yKn16RkPgng4eHkdCkx